How would you describe the overall character and environment of O'Connor?
O'Connor is an affluent suburb known for its leafy, heritage‑listed streets and detached single‑dwelling houses. It features the Bruce/O'Connor ridge nature reserve, hilly tree‑lined areas and a small local shopping centre
Are there any heritage‑listed sites or historic landmarks near the property?
Yes, nearby heritage‑listed sites include the Tocumwal Houses, which were moved to O'Connor after World War II, and the Scout Hall at the corner of Hovea Street and Boronia Drive. Several Aboriginal places on the Bruce and O'Connor Ridges are also heritage listed
